How to calculate the gas consumption of bottle blowing machine

2026-04-15Views:

The calculation of the gas consumption of the bottle blowing machine should be combined with the working principle of the equipment, production efficiency and actual gas demand to ensure that the capacity of the air compressor matches the bottle blowing process. The specific calculation method is as follows:

the core calculation logic of the gas consumption of the 1. bottle blowing machine.

The bottle blowing machine inflates the preform by compressed air, and the air consumption mainly depends on the following factors:

1. Gas consumption of a single bottle (V)

refers to the volume of compressed air required to inflate a bottle (unit: liters/bottle). This value is usually provided by the bottle blowing machine manufacturer or obtained by actual measurement (e. g. using a flow meter). If it is not possible to obtain accurate data, refer to the experience value of similar equipment (for example, the air consumption of common PET bottle blowing is about 5-15 liters/bottle).

2. Production speed (N)

refers to the number of bottles produced by the blowing machine per minute (unit: bottles/minute). If the equipment is multi-station synchronous operation, the total production speed needs to be multiplied by the number of stations (e. g. 4 station equipment, each station produces 10 bottles/min, the total speed is 40 bottles/min).

3. Calculation formula of gas consumption

the total gas consumption (Q, in cubic meters per minute) can be calculated by the following formula:
Q =(N × V)÷ 1000
(Note: 1 cubic meter = 1000 liters, the liter needs to be converted to cubic meters)

precautions in 2. Actual Calculation

1. Pressure correction (if required)

the bottle blowing machine usually requires a compressed air pressure of 2.5-3.5MPa (subject to equipment requirements). If the gas consumption is expressed by volume under standard atmospheric pressure (0.1MPa), it shall be corrected according to the actual pressure:
actual gas consumption (Q actual) = Q × (actual pressure ÷ 0.1)
(Example: When the pressure is 3MPa, Q actually = Q× 30)

2. Reservation of margin

in order to cope with pipeline leakage, gas fluctuation or future capacity increase, it is recommended to increase 10%-20% margin on the basis of total gas consumption:
recommended air compressor capacity = Q actual ×(1.1-1.2)

4. example description

assuming that the bottle blowing machine is a 4-station equipment, each station produces 12 bottles/min, and the gas consumption of a single bottle is 8 liters:

  • total production speed N = 4 × 12=48 bottles/min
  • total gas consumption (under standard pressure) Q = 48 × 8 ÷ 1000=0.384 m3/min
  • if the actual pressure is 3MPa,Q actual = 0.384 × 30=11.52 m3/min
  • after reserving 20% allowance, it is recommended that the capacity of the air compressor be ≥ 11.52 × 1.2 & asymp;13.82 m3/min

to sum up, the calculation of the gas consumption of the bottle blowing machine should be combined with the production speed, the gas consumption of a single bottle and the pressure requirements, and the appropriate margin should be reserved.
